The ancient Stannary town of Chagford offers a wide variety of day to day and specialist shops, four pubs, cafes and restaurant and a bustling town square. There is a Primary school, pre-school and Montessori, a library, Parish church, Roman Catholic church and chapel and surgeries for doctor, dentist and vet. The town is surrounded by countryside, riverside and moorland walks and the sports facilities are excellent with football and cricket pitches, a tennis club, bowling club, skate park, children's play park and an open air swimming pool in the summertime. The A30 dual carriageway is about 5 miles away and Exeter is about 20 miles.
